Hormonal issues are a common concern among individuals of all ages, genders, and backgrounds. Hormones are chemical messengers produced by various glands in the body that control and regulate numerous bodily functions such as growth, metabolism, reproduction, and mood.

Hormonal imbalances can occur due to a variety of reasons such as stress, poor nutrition, lack of exercise, aging, and underlying medical conditions. These imbalances can result in a wide range of symptoms and health problems, ranging from fatigue and weight gain to infertility and mood disorders.

One of the most common hormonal issues is thyroid dysfunction. The thyroid gland produces hormones that regulate metabolism, body temperature, and energy levels. Hypothyroidism occurs when the thyroid gland is not producing enough hormones, resulting in symptoms such as fatigue, weight gain, depression, and cold intolerance. Hyperthyroidism, on the other hand, occurs when the thyroid gland is producing too many hormones, leading to symptoms such as weight loss, anxiety, and heat intolerance.

Another common hormonal issue is insulin resistance and diabetes . Insulin is a hormone produced by the pancreas that regulates blood sugar levels in the body. Insulin resistance occurs when the body becomes less responsive to insulin, leading to high blood sugar levels and eventually diabetes. Diabetes can lead to a host of health problems such as heart disease, kidney failure, and nerve damage.

Hormonal imbalances can also affect reproductive health, particularly in women. Pol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S)  is a hormonal disorder that affects women of reproductive age. It is characterized by high levels of androgens (male hormones) in the body, which can lead to irregular periods, acne, weight gain, and infertility. Hormonal imbalances can also affect men’s reproductive health, leading to low testosterone levels, reduced libido, and infertility.

In addition to these specific hormonal issues, hormonal imbalances can also cause a range of other symptoms such as mood swings, irritability, insomnia, and anxiety. These symptoms can be challenging to diagnose and treat, as hormonal imbalances can be caused by a variety of factors.
Treatment for hormonal issues often involves lifestyle changes such as diet and exercise, stress management techniques, and medication. It is essential to seek medical advice if you suspect you have a hormonal issue, as timely diagnosis and treatment can help prevent long-term health problems.
